Description
Transformation leadership is a powerful leadership style that can inspire positive changes in those who follow. Transformational leaders are often energetic, enthusiastic, and passionate, creating a vision for their followers and guiding the change through inspiration and motivation.
In this presentation, our speaker, Gayle Johnson, will help you understand what transformational leadership is, how you become a transformational leader and why you would want to be a transformational leader. Transformational leadership is about understanding yourself and understanding others. To be transformational, especially in this day and age, it is about operating from within, showing up as your authentic self, caring for others and building relationships. Transformational is the impact you have on others. At the end of the day, transformational leadership is about how you make people feel.
To sum this up, here is a quote by Maya Angelou:
“I’ve learned that people will forget what you said, people will forget what you did, but people will never forget how you made them feel.”

Speaker
Gayle Johnson is the founder of EVOLVE Life Coaching. She helps companies and governmental organizations maximize employee effectiveness through emotional intelligence leadership training and coaching. Gayle is a Seattle native. She graduated from Roosevelt High School, attended the legendary Spelman College in Atlanta, GA, and then transferred to the University of Washington, where she received a B.A. Degree in Political Science.
Gayle says of her experience: “I have enjoyed the role of political strategist, workshop facilitator, and transformational leader for over 20 years. My effective leadership style has been developed through coaching high-level leadership, mid-management, and frontline employees on the importance of emotional intelligence, and how applying it creates high-performing teams, helps retain good talent and ultimately increases revenue. To support my experience as a transformational thought leader, I pursued a Master of Transformational Leadership at Seattle University. This knowledge informs my understanding of the theory behind what it takes to be an impactful leader, team member, employee, and how to manage one’s emotions while working in diverse organizations and managing the new demographic of employees – Millennials. I love people and enjoy seeing them access their happiness and move their lives forward.”
